WebNov 18, 2024 · Specifically, the researchers reported, prior infection with Omicron was 79.7% effective at preventing BA.4 and BA.5 reinfection and 76.1% effective at preventing symptomatic reinfection. New Delhi, April 14 (IANS) With India currently seeing a rise in both Covid and influenza cases, many people are likely to be co-infected by the viruses, which can turn fatal if not treated on time, health experts said on Friday. Increasing genome surveillance and active follow-up may also help, they noted.
